ISMT E-120

24
Page 1 ISMT E-120 Desktop Applications for Managers Integrating Applications

description

ISMT E-120. Desktop Applications for Managers. Integrating Applications. Integrating Applications. Clipboard Intermediate Formats Exporting & Importing Mail Merge – Excel & Access Integrated Query Object Linking & Embedding Hyperlinks. Integrating Applications. Clipboard - PowerPoint PPT Presentation

Transcript of ISMT E-120

Page 1: ISMT E-120

Page 1

ISMT E-120Desktop Applications for Managers

Integrating Applications

Page 2: ISMT E-120

2

Integrating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ding• Hyperlinks

Page 3: ISMT E-120

3

Integrating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ding• Hyperlinks

Page 4: ISMT E-120

4

Clipboard

• Small Application• Always available• Converts Formats• Windows vs. Office Clipboard

Page 5: ISMT E-120

5

Intermediate Formats

• Text Only– Loses formatting, some content– Lowest denominator– Can be delimited (tab, “”, space, …)

• RTF: Rich Text Format– File contains only text characters– Preserves visual content and format

Page 6: ISMT E-120

6

Exporting and Importing

• Export Source document knows about destinationOR Converts to intermediate format

• Import Destination document knows about sourceOR Source converted to intermediate format

Page 7: ISMT E-120

7

Export Examples

• Access to Excel• Excel To Access

Page 8: ISMT E-120

8

Import Examples

• Access from Excel Import Link

• HTML

Page 9: ISMT E-120

9

Integrating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ding• Hyperlinks

Page 10: ISMT E-120

10

Mail Merge

• Excel– Entire worksheet as source

• Access– Table as source– Query results as source

Page 11: ISMT E-120

11

Integrating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ding• Hyperlinks

Page 12: ISMT E-120

12

Integrated Query

• Query– Data in Excel– Data in Access

Page 13: ISMT E-120

13

Microsoft Query

• Query Engine from Access• Invoke from Excel• ODBC

– Standard protocol– Drivers for different databases– Masks idiosyncrasies among databases

Page 14: ISMT E-120

14

Integrating Applications

Cooperative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ding (OLE)• Hyperlinks

Page 15: ISMT E-120

15

Object Embedding

• Copy of source object embedded• No live link maintained• Edit source object within container• More portable – all components go• Files larger

Page 16: ISMT E-120

16

Object Linking

• Live link between two applications• Change in source updates destination

document• Stores only the location of the original

data, not data itself• Not as portable – why?

Page 17: ISMT E-120

17

Using OLE

• Text-oriented example

• Presentation-oriented example

• Database-oriented example

Page 18: ISMT E-120

18

Using OLE - Example• Spreadsheet

• Sound clip

• Database ??

Calls Worksheet

Page 19: ISMT E-120

19

Integrating Applications• Clipboard• Intermediate Formats• Exporting & Importing• Mail Merge – Excel & Access• Integrated Query• Object Linking & Embedding• Document Hyperlinks

Page 20: ISMT E-120

20

Document Hyperlinks

• File• Named Object Within File• Web Page• FTP Site

Page 21: ISMT E-120

21

Hyperlinks: Word

• Bookmark within a Word document• Hyperlink to other Word documents• And to Excel• … to PowerPoint• … to Access

Page 22: ISMT E-120

22

Hyperlinks: Excel

• Worksheet• Named Range of Cells• Not Defined Names

Page 23: ISMT E-120

23

Hyperlinks: PowerPoint

• Word– Document, Bookmark, Web Page

• Excel– Worksheet, Named Range

• PowerPoint– Slide Name or Number

Page 24: ISMT E-120

24

Hyperlinks: Access

• Table• Form• Report• Object-type object-name syntax• Hyperlink to Access database form